#6827d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6827dd is composed of 40.8% red, 15.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.9% cyan, 82.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 261.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 51%. #6827dd color hex could be obtained by blending #d04eff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#6827d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6827dd has RGB values of R:104, G:39,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 6825949.

Shades and Tints of #6827d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f6f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6827dd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817e86 is the less saturated color, while #600afa is the most saturated one.
